These systems are ideal for homeowners seeking reliable backup power, peak load shifting, and long-term energy cost savings. Key factors include usable capacity (9. 6-215 kWh), round-trip efficiency (~90%), lifespan (6,000+ cycles), and compatibility with existing solar setups.
A solar panel system includes several crucial components: solar panels (the array), racking and mounting fixtures, inverters, a disconnect switch, and an optional solar battery for energy storage.

BESS is designed to convert and store electricity, often sourced from renewables or accumulated during periods of low demand when electricity rates are more economical.
